Merge tag 'u-boot-dfu-20240111' of https://source.denx.de/u-boot/custodians/u-boot-dfu
u-boot-dfu-20240111 - Implement fastboot multi-response. This allows multi-line response and most importantly, finally adds support for fastboot getvar all command. - New 'fastboot oem console' command. Useful for debugging to send data the u-boot shell via fastboot - Console recording fixes
